Default Late up date

hi gurus sorry for the late reply on the cutting out update.

long story short guys it's was the fule pump.
the fule pump couldn't deliver the fule need.

so now have a Mitsubishi racing pump
I cleaned the carbs replaced float pin
bike runs better than ever before.

Default brass T piece

Originally Posted by Halftonmum
Hello mate, where would you find these brass T pieces? Seen some on fleabay but not sure if they're the right size
the fule T piece I think off top of my head is a 5mm and the air piece is 8mm.

double check I no I am replying late sorry 😐.
once you know the size the important thing to take note is the rubber 0 rings.

Make sure they suitable for petrol! if not then they will perish causing major fule Leake NOT GOOD.
